In the medical care segment, sensory switches play a critical role in enhancing patient comfort and ensuring better accessibility. These switches are widely used in medical devices such as bed control units, patient monitoring systems, and other assistive technology. The primary advantage of sensory switches in this sector lies in their ability to enable non-invasive control for patients, particularly those with physical disabilities or limited mobility. By providing intuitive, touch-based, or pressure-sensitive interfaces, sensory switches help patients and healthcare providers interact more effectively with medical equipment. Moreover, sensory switches are often incorporated in environments like hospitals and rehabilitation centers, where quick, reliable, and easy-to-use switches are essential to improving patient care outcomes.
The medical sector’s growing demand for sensory switches is also driven by the increasing focus on patient-centric care. For instance, sensory switches help to enhance the user experience for elderly patients, children, and individuals with cognitive or physical impairments. Furthermore, as medical technology continues to evolve with advances in smart healthcare, the integration of sensory switches is expected to become more prevalent, particularly in wearable devices, prosthetics, and other health-focused applications. The growing adoption of digital health and telemedicine solutions further bolsters the demand for reliable, user-friendly control systems in the healthcare sector.
The toys and game equipment segment represents one of the most dynamic applications of sensory switches, particularly in the creation of interactive, engaging, and educational play experiences. Sensory switches are commonly used in toys that require user input such as touch-sensitive toys, motion-activated games, and interactive learning tools. These switches help provide immediate, tactile feedback that enhances the user experience and supports cognitive development in children. Additionally, sensory switches are often used in products aimed at children with special needs, offering them a more intuitive and accessible means of interaction. In this segment, sensory switches are becoming increasingly popular due to the growing emphasis on creating smarter, more immersive play experiences that cater to a diverse range of children, including those with disabilities.
The increasing popularity of STEM-based (Science, Technology, Engineering, and Mathematics) toys and smart games further promotes the growth of sensory switches in the toys and game equipment market. Companies are developing innovative games and educational toys that incorporate sensory switches to stimulate learning and interaction. These devices often use sensory triggers like light, sound, or movement, making the playtime experience more engaging. As demand grows for interactive and high-tech toys, the role of sensory switches in promoting user engagement and providing feedback will continue to grow. The increasing focus on early childhood education is also likely to push the use of these technologies, ensuring that sensory switches remain a key component in the development of educational and recreational products.

What are sensory switches?
Sensory switches are devices that respond to physical stimuli like touch, pressure, or motion, enabling user interaction with various electronic systems.
How are sensory switches used in medical devices?
In medical devices, sensory switches are used to improve accessibility, allowing patients with limited mobility to interact with equipment easily and intuitively.
What is the role of sensory switches in toys?
Sensory switches in toys enable interactive and engaging experiences by responding to touch or motion, enhancing playtime and educational value.
Are sensory switches used in smart home devices?
Yes, sensory switches are commonly used in smart home systems for controlling lighting, heating, entertainment, and security with intuitive interfaces.
What industries benefit from sensory switches?
Key industries benefiting from sensory switches include healthcare, automotive, consumer electronics, and the toys and game equipment sector.
How do sensory switches improve user experience?
Sensory switches improve user experience by offering tactile, non-invasive controls that are easy to use and intuitive, enhancing accessibility and convenience.
What types of sensory switches are available?
Common types of sensory switches include touch-sensitive, pressure-sensitive, and motion-activated switches, each designed for specific applications.
